In the MODIS cloud product hdf files (MOD03, MYD03) some data sets are stored with the band dimension last instead of first.
gdalinfo myfile.hdf (or gdal.Dataset.GetSubDatasets) yields: [snip] SUBDATASET_52_NAME=HDF4_EOS:EOS_SWATH:'myfile.hdf':mod06:Cloud_Mask_1km SUBDATASET_52_DESC=[2040x1354x2] Cloud_Mask_1km mod06 (8-bit integer) [snip]
So obviously there are two bands of size 2040x1354 in the subdataset. However, in order for gdal to recognize them as two bands the dimensions would have to be [2x2040x1354].
Accordingly, when I do gdalinfo HDF4_EOS:EOS_SWATH:'myfile.hdf':mod06:Cloud_Mask_1km I get information on 2040 different bands, each of size 1354x2
It would be useful to have a feature in gdal that allows explicit selection of the dimension that holds the band count or even let gdal decide on this.
